Villains and Threats

Davos’ Descent

Davos emerges as a formidable antagonist, his transformation into the Steel Serpent presenting a direct challenge to Danny’s claim to the Iron Fist. The brotherly conflict between Davos and Danny adds a deeply personal layer to the overarching battle, enriching the narrative with themes of betrayal, rivalry, and redemption.

The Triad War

The escalation of the Triad war in New York provides a backdrop for the season’s action, drawing Danny and his allies into a larger conflict that threatens the peace of the city. This storyline amplifies the stakes, weaving together the personal and the larger battle for the soul of New York.
